FAQs - OEM vs Aftermarket Parts

What's the difference between OEM and aftermarket parts?

OEM stands for Original Equipment Manufacturer, meaning these parts are made by Mitsubishi or by a supplier to Mitsubishi's exact specifications. Aftermarket parts are produced by companies independent of Mitsubishi and can vary widely in quality, fit, and performance. Genuine OEM parts are designed to integrate seamlessly with your vehicle's existing systems.

How often should I replace brake pads?

The lifespan of brake pads varies significantly based on driving habits, road conditions, and the type of pads used. As a general guideline, brake pads should be inspected regularly during routine maintenance and replaced when they are worn down to about 3-4 millimeters thickness. Listen for any squealing or grinding sounds, which are indicators they need attention.

When do I need new rotors vs just pads?

Brake pads are designed to wear down and are replaced more frequently than rotors. Rotors should be replaced if they are significantly worn, warped, or grooved, which can cause vibration or reduce braking effectiveness. Your technician at Albany Mitsubishi can assess the condition of your rotors during a brake inspection.

What's the difference between all-season and winter tires?

All-season tires offer a balance of performance in various conditions, including light snow and rain, making them a popular choice for drivers around Albany, GA. Winter tires, however, are specifically designed with a softer rubber compound and deeper tread patterns to provide superior grip and traction in colder temperatures, snow, and ice.

When should I replace my battery?

The lifespan of a car battery typically ranges from 3 to 5 years, but this can be influenced by climate and usage. In warmer climates like Albany, GA, batteries can sometimes degrade faster due to heat. If you notice slow engine cranking, dimming lights, or your battery warning light illuminates, it's time to have it inspected.

How does Albany, GA heat/cold affect battery life?

Extreme temperatures, both hot and cold, can impact battery performance and lifespan. The intense heat in Albany, GA can cause battery fluids to evaporate and accelerate internal corrosion, while extreme cold can reduce the battery's cranking power. Proper maintenance and timely replacement are key to ensuring consistent starting power.

How do Albany, GA potholes affect suspension parts?

The roads around Albany, GA, like many others, can present challenges from potholes. Repeated impacts from hitting potholes can stress and eventually damage suspension components such as shocks, struts, and ball joints. If you notice new noises or a change in your vehicle's handling, it's wise to have your suspension inspected.
